我正在使用 MyBB 运行 Web 服务器,Pingdom 表示加载我网站的索引需要 629 毫秒。我想知道是否有办法降低这个时间。这是我掌握的有关页面生成时间的信息:
MyBB Debug Information
Page Generation
Page Generation Statistics
Page Generation Time: 55 ms No. DB Queries: 16
PHP Processing Time: 53 ms (96.13%) DB Processing Time: 2 ms (3.87%)
Extensions Used: mysqli, xml Global.php Processing Time: 47 ms
PHP Version: 5.5.9-1ubuntu4.19 Server Load: 0
GZip Encoding Status: Disabled No. Templates Used: 78 (75 Cached / 3 Manually Loaded)
Memory Usage: 2.5 MB (2621440 bytes) Memory Limit: 128M
为了提供进一步的调试信息,我提供了 Pingdom 站点速度测试的此链接,以提供有关该页面的更多信息:https://tools.pingdom.com/#!/bSkZOI/https://sinful.pw/
我正在尝试优化网站,使其运行速度尽可能快。我正在运行 apache2 网络服务器,想知道我可以采取哪些步骤来尽可能优化它的加载时间。我还在网站前面安装了 CloudFlare,因为它们会缓存某些文件。PHP5 配置为利用操作码缓存。
编辑:这不是重复的问题。我问的是如何优化我的 Web 服务器,而不是如何进行负载测试。有人能解释一下它们有何相似之处吗?
答案1
提高网站速度的半自动化方法是在 Apache 上安装 mod_pagespeed,这几乎不需要深入了解系统的内部工作原理。请按照以下指南进行操作:
https://developers.google.com/speed/pagespeed/module/download